/**
* @brief Attribute data for packet action
*/
typedef enum _sai_packet_action_t
{
/* Basic Packet Actions */
/*
* These could be further classified based on the nature of action
* - Data Plane Packet Actions
* - CPU Path Packet Actions
*/
/*
* Data Plane Packet Actions.
*
* Following two packet actions only affect the packet action on the data plane.
* Packet action on the CPU path remains unchanged.
*/
/** Drop Packet in data plane */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_DROP,
/** Forward Packet in data plane. */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_FORWARD,
/*
* CPU Path Packet Actions.
*
* Following two packet actions only affect the packet action on the CPU path.
* Packet action on the data plane remains unchanged.
*/
/**
* @brief Packet action copy
*
* Copy Packet to CPU without interfering the original packet action in the
* pipeline.
*/
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_COPY,
/** Cancel copy the packet to CPU. */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_COPY_CANCEL,
/** Combination of Packet Actions */
/**
* @brief Packet action trap
*
* This is a combination of SAI packet action COPY and DROP:
* A copy of the original packet is sent to CPU port, the original
* packet is forcefully dropped from the pipeline.
*/
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_TRAP,
/**
* @brief Packet action log
*
* This is a combination of SAI packet action COPY and FORWARD:
* A copy of the original packet is sent to CPU port, the original
* packet, if it was to be dropped in the original pipeline,
* change the pipeline action to forward (cancel drop).
*/
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_LOG,
/** This is a combination of SAI packet action COPY_CANCEL and DROP */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_DENY,
/** This is a combination of SAI packet action COPY_CANCEL and FORWARD */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_TRANSIT,
/** Do not drop the packet. */
SAI_PACKET_ACTION_DONOTDROP
} sai_packet_action_t;

/**
* @brief Attribute data for SAI_SWITCH_ATTR_HOSTIF_OPER_STATUS_UPDATE_MODE.
*/
typedef enum _sai_switch_hostif_oper_status_update_mode_t
{
/**
* @brief Application mode.
*
* In this mode, operational status of hostif must be updated by application
* using hostif API with SAI_HOSTIF_ATTR_OPER_STATUS attribute. SAI adapter
* should not update the hostif operational status internally.
* When a host interface is created, application must update the operational
* status if required and should not rely on SAI adapter to update it.
*/
SAI_SWITCH_HOSTIF_OPER_STATUS_UPDATE_MODE_APPLICATION = 0,
/**
* @brief SAI adapter mode.
*
* In this mode, operational status of hostif is updated internally by SAI
* adapter. Update of hostif operational status by application using hostif
* API with SAI_HOSTIF_ATTR_OPER_STATUS is ignored.
*/
SAI_SWITCH_HOSTIF_OPER_STATUS_UPDATE_MODE_SAI_ADAPTER = 1,
} sai_switch_hostif_oper_status_update_mode_t;
